Open Air Food Factory - Weighing in Peas, California, 1939
EDITORS COMMENTS
. This photograph by Dorothea Lange takes us back to the heart of America's agricultural history. In the midst of the Great Depression, Lange captures a poignant moment at an open-air food factory in California. The image showcases a group of hardworking agricultural workers weighing baskets filled with freshly harvested peas. The scene is bustling with activity as men and women dressed in bib overalls and bonnets diligently carry out their tasks under the scorching sun. Their attire reflects both practicality and resilience amidst challenging times. A farmhand wearing a cowboy hat stands tall among his peers, symbolizing the spirit of American perseverance. Lange's composition not only documents this crucial aspect of American life but also highlights the economic significance of farming during that era. The vast farmland stretching into the distance serves as a reminder of our country's rich agricultural heritage. Through her lens, Lange encapsulates both hardship and determination etched on each face present in this snapshot from history. This powerful image speaks volumes about the impact of economic depression on ordinary people who relied on agriculture for their livelihoods.
